Book Synopsis
Directors and officers of organizations grapple with how to manage and govern cyber risks. From asking simple questions about whether their company has a mature cybersecurity program to fielding more complex queries about ransomware and cyber insurance, boards and executives should understand what cyber governance really means and how they should be exercising oversight of digital risks. This practical and timely guide will help directors and officers, and those who counsel them, understand how to appropriately govern cyber risks. Written by leading expert Jody Westby, this resource provides the basic information directors and officers need to know to meet their fiduciary duties, exercise appropriate cyber governance, and protect their organization against shareholder derivative and securities lawsuits. Practical and user-friendly, this guidebook contains checklists, practice tips, charts, and resources to help you: Develop a governance framework in alignment with best practices and standards Understand the elements of a cybersecurity program Ensure privacy and security compliance requirements are met Manage a cybersecurity incident and make hard decisions Develop appropriate risk transfer and management strategies And more! As an added bonus, the book includes a cyber governance checklist, a cyber lingo cheat sheet, and a list of abbreviations that serve as a guide and reference.
